Donna M. Sinley, 64 , went to be with the Lord on Sunday, July 8, 2019.

Born and raised in Wooster, she was a resident of Akron for 42 years, and was a retired homemaker. An avid lover of Jesus Christ and voracious reader, Donna loved many things, including tending to her garden, cooking, and crafting.

Preceded in death were her husband, Neil; parents, Arlene Mae and Paul Edward Smith Sr.; brothers, Charles, Paul and Richard; and sister, Catherine.

She is survived by sons; Mark, Matthew and Rob Hicks; sister, Joan D. Gordon; granddaughters, Tristen and Taylor; dear friends, Edith Hartley and Julie Berlyak; and faithful and fuzzy companions, Calli (dog) and Abbi (cat).

In lieu of flowers, please consider; reading Colossians 3:16, donating to your local humane society, or - try to be a good person.

A funeral service will take place on Monday July 15, 2019 at 11am at Newcomer, Akron Chapel, 131 N. Canton Rd., Akron, OH 44305, with an hour of visitation prior. Interment to follow at Ohio Western Reserve National Cemetery at 12:45pm.
